"Hyperhidrosis of the hands" sounds familiar yet strange, and it troubles many people's lives. When the patient is ill, sweat pours down his hands, regardless of the season or location. Some people's palms are always sweaty, which may cause them to slip when holding a pen while studying for an exam, or when holding the steering wheel while driving, or even make it difficult for them to do jobs such as hairdressing or repairing precision instruments because of their slippery palms. Over time, some patients may develop strange personalities, have a sense of inferiority, and dare not shake hands, dare not go to parties, and refuse to socialize.

"Hyperhidrosis of the hands" is a member of the hyperhidrosis family, which is characterized by sweating in multiple parts of the body. Once the hands sweat, 70% of people will also sweat on their feet, 30% will sweat on their faces, and 5% will also sweat on their heads. According to survey statistics, the incidence of hyperhidrosis of the hands among young people in mainland China is about 2.8%, which is common in teenagers and adolescents. It usually starts at the age of 8-12, and the symptoms are most obvious before the age of 30. Congenital family inheritance accounts for 25%.

The cause of constant sweating is actually this

When talking about the cause of "hyperhidrosis of the palms", we have to mention a key word - "sympathetic nerve excitement". The sympathetic nerves and parasympathetic nerves are combined into the autonomic nerves, which are not dominated and controlled by the brain. Once the autonomic nerves are disordered, the corresponding organs of the body, including the sweat glands, will be out of balance. "Hyperhidrosis of the palms" is caused by the overexcitement of the sympathetic nerves, which causes excessive sweating of the sweat glands in the palms.

According to the degree of excessive sweating, "hyperhidrosis of hands" can be divided into three levels: mild: moist palms; moderate: sweat on the palms is so severe that a handkerchief is soaked; severe: sweat on the palms forms drops of sweat, and sometimes can flow down the fingers, which will cause troubles to people's work, study and life.

To solve the problem of sweaty hands, you can try minimally invasive radiofrequency treatment

Although "Hyperhidrosis" will not affect physical health, it will have a great impact on the patient's life and work. "Hyperhidrosis" is not an incurable disease, and many hospitals' analgesia clinics can provide relevant treatment for it. For patients with "hyperhidrosis", the analgesia clinic will use CT to guide the puncture needle from the chest and back to the thoracic sympathetic ganglion at the front edge of the 4th rib head, and then use a radiofrequency needle to destroy the 4th sympathetic nerve at high temperature to achieve the purpose of controlling sweaty hands. This treatment is hospitalized and discharged on the same day, with a high success rate of surgery and immediate good results.
